Step through the solid wooden door and you're greeted by a light-filled open-plan living space that makes the most of the barn's heritage. Chunky exposed beams crisscross overhead like a giant's game of pick-up-sticks, and vaulted ceilings give a sense of airy spaciousness. Slate floors underfoot add to the authentic feel, while leather recliners invite you to flop down with a cuppa (or a glass of wine from your welcome hamper yes, there's bara brith too).
The kitchen runs along one wall with warm shaker cabinets, tiled splashbacks and everything you need for a self-catering break - double oven, microwave, and enough worktop space for even the most ambitious holiday bake-off. Set the dining table beneath the beams for family feasts or a lazy breakfast as sunlight pours through the big windows.
Two bedrooms keep things simple and restful. The double room has soft neutral tones, fluffy pillows, and warm bedside lighting for late-night page-turners. The twin room is cheerful and colourful, perfect for kids or friends who don't fancy sharing. The modern bathroom adds a little luxury with marble-effect tiles and a walk-in rainfall shower - perfect for washing off sandy toes after a day at Harlech beach.
Outside, a large enclosed patio catches the sun all day. Sip your morning coffee as you watch the mist lift over the estuary or enjoy an al fresco supper with views stretching towards Portmeirion and the mountains beyond. It's dog friendly too, so your four-legged family members can join you for those scenic adventures.
Beudy-Talsarnau is the kind of place where you can disconnect from the daily grind without feeling cut off - there's Wi-Fi, a Smart TV and plenty of board games for rainy days. But with so much to explore nearby, you'll probably spend more time out than in.

About the area
Talsarnau
Talsarnau is home to this cottage. Eryri National Park and Barmouth Beach reflect the area's natural beauty and area attractions include Hufenfa'r Castell and Ffestiniog & Welsh Highland Railways. Y Ganolfan Arts Centre and Glaslyn Leisure Centre are also worth visiting.
